China to Jamaica Air Freight Transit Times
China to Jamaica air freight transit times typically range from 3-10 days, mainly influenced by route selection, customs clearance efficiency and external factors. Direct transit routes (e.g. via Miami) can be fastest at 3-5 days, while Europe or Middle East transits take 5-8 days. Customs clearance usually takes 1-3 days.
Factors Affecting Transit Times:
Route Selection: Direct transits (via Miami/New York) take 3-5 days. Europe/Middle East transits (e.g. Frankfurt/Doha) take 5-8 days. Economy transits (e.g. Panama/postal routes) take 7-15 days.
Customs Clearance Time: Jamaica Kingston Airport (KIN) clearance typically takes 1-2 days (with complete documentation). Montego Bay Airport (MBJ) clearance may extend to 2-3 days (smaller processing capacity).
Other Factors: Peak seasons (e.g. pre-Christmas) may add 1-3 days transit queuing time. Special cargo (e.g. hazardous materials, perishables) require additional approval time.

Price Notes:
Price Range: Above prices are per kg transportation costs, specific prices vary by cargo weight, volume and transportation methods. For example, prices are relatively lower for shipments over 100kg.
Key Factors Affecting China to Jamaica Air Freight Prices:
Transit Routes: Few direct flights from China to Jamaica, mostly transiting via Miami (MIA) or Europe (e.g. AMS/FRA), potentially increasing costs and transit times (typically 3-7 days).
Peak Season Adjustments: September approaches US/EU holiday seasons (e.g. Thanksgiving), some routes may increase prices by 10%-20%.
Cargo Types: General cargo: Regular goods without special requirements. Sensitive cargo: Battery-powered, liquids, powders etc. requiring additional fees.
Other Fees: Fuel surcharges, tariffs (based on Jamaica HS codes), customs clearance fees (approx. USD 80-150/shipment).
